查询数据库占用的空间是

查询数据库占用的空间是

作者:Joshua Lee发布时间:2026-04-09 11:53阅读时长:15 分钟阅读次数:10
常见问答
Q
如何查看数据库当前使用的存储空间?

我想了解如何查询数据库已经占用了多少磁盘空间,有哪些方法可以查看?

A

查看数据库占用空间的常见方法

可以通过数据库管理系统提供的命令或者工具来查看数据库占用的存储空间。例如,在MySQL中可以使用 'SHOW TABLE STATUS' 查询表空间信息,或者使用 'information_schema' 数据库中的相关表统计空间使用情况;在Oracle中可以查询数据字典视图如 DBA_SEGMENTS 来获取占用空间详情。

Q
有哪些工具可以帮助监控数据库空间使用情况?

有没有一些数据库监控工具,能够实时或者定期报告数据库使用的存储空间?

A

常见数据库空间监控工具推荐

多种数据库监控工具支持空间使用情况的监控,比如MySQL的Percona Monitoring and Management,Oracle的Enterprise Manager,以及开源的Prometheus配合Grafana。它们不仅监控空间使用,还能帮助分析性能和资源瓶颈。

Q
数据库占用空间过大对系统有何影响?

如果数据库占用的空间持续增加且很大,会对系统或者应用产生什么不良影响?

A

数据库空间过大可能导致的问题

占用空间过大的数据库可能会导致硬盘资源紧张,影响数据库性能,查询速度降低,备份和恢复时间延长。同时,这可能导致数据库维护成本增加和系统稳定性下降,需定期清理或优化数据库以保证系统健康运行。

* 文章含AI生成内容